Junchao Ma is a scholar working on Health, Toxicology and Mutagenesis, Electrical and Electronic Engineering and Pollution. According to data from OpenAlex, Junchao Ma has authored 24 papers receiving a total of 301 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Health, Toxicology and Mutagenesis, 7 papers in Electrical and Electronic Engineering and 5 papers in Pollution. Recurrent topics in Junchao Ma's work include Pharmaceutical and Antibiotic Environmental Impacts (5 papers), Effects and risks of endocrine disrupting chemicals (4 papers) and Toxic Organic Pollutants Impact (4 papers). Junchao Ma is often cited by papers focused on Pharmaceutical and Antibiotic Environmental Impacts (5 papers), Effects and risks of endocrine disrupting chemicals (4 papers) and Toxic Organic Pollutants Impact (4 papers). Junchao Ma collaborates with scholars based in China, Egypt and United States. Junchao Ma's co-authors include Chao Qin, Wanting Ling, Zeming Wang, Tingting Wang, Chao Cheng, Zhongkun Du, Lusheng Zhu, Jun Wang, Xiaojie Hu and Xiaojie Hu and has published in prestigious journals such as Applied Physics Letters, The Science of The Total Environment and Journal of Hazardous Materials.
